Route notes

Kentucky's landscape is characterized by constant rises and valleys, and the continuously rolling terrain can make routes feel more challenging than the mileage may suggest. There are no flat sections of riding on this trip.

Straight talk

We want to make sure you're on the right trip and that you have the best experience possible. Every Backroads trip is unique and this one is no exception.

Roads & Traffic

Kentucky is filled with scenic country roads; however, many of them are narrow and lack a proper shoulder. On some occasions we have to bike on short sections of busier road to connect the best biking routes. Of course, you're always welcome to jump in the shuttle to avoid the more trafficked sections.

Accommodation

On the first night of the trip we stay at the Shaker Village Inn, a Casual Hotel. This historic hotel is purposefully designed in a minimalist style that reflects the Shaker philosophy. This means simple rooms with fewer amenities than one might find at a typical Backroads hotel.
